Web5 jan. 2024 · The minerals in our food and water are essential for a variety of normal bodily functions. • Recovery functions – building strong bones, teeth, and other body tissue. • Hydration functions – controlling body fluids inside and outside cells. • Metabolic functions – turning the food you eat into energy. Furthermore, if the calcium concentration surpasses 100 ppm, the water will taste … bioparc ofertas 2x1 2021Web1 okt. 2024 · Carbonated water that solely contains water and carbon dioxide is considered to be a healthy beverage. It hydrates just as well as regular water does. However, some carbonated waters contain additives and other ingredients that decreases their health benefits.
